Transaction 1496857a4e217f1860ec682c3b1ee35e677f2214f664d646e85cab9a09d79b6c

2 Input
2 Outputs
  • 1496857a4e217f1860ec682c3b1ee35e677f2214f664d646e85cab9a09d79b6c:0
  • value  3000000
    address  3Ljgw9yYMaUYTLftiYEps6eceNPgPd2eCR
  • 1496857a4e217f1860ec682c3b1ee35e677f2214f664d646e85cab9a09d79b6c:1
  • value  4250893
    address  1LaKkDDyXQypdFvyhUr63jUZRisuXTCbdA